RadioShack close to closing


Posted by: Timothy Weaver on 02/02/2015 04:07 PM [ comments Comments ]


RadioShack has roughly 4,300 stores across North America and it has plans to sell half of those stores to Sprint.



If it can't find a buyer for the rest, it will close them. Workers at stores have already told reporters they have been directed to ship inventory to other stores and cut prices on the rest.

Older "nerds" will remember the Tandy line of computers affectionately called the "trash 80" ( an allusion to the model name TRS-80 ). RadioShack's TRS-80 Model 100 was one of the last products that Bill Gates actually wrote the software for.

RadioShack opened its first store in downtown Boston in 1921, but it never lost the reputation for being cheesy and cheap.


It will be a sad day for many of the tube testers from the 80's.
